Skip site navigation (1)Skip section navigation (2)
Date:      Thu, 4 Oct 2012 17:08:10 -0700
From:      Garrett Cooper <yanegomi@gmail.com>
To:        Adrian Chadd <adrian@freebsd.org>
Cc:        svn-src-head@freebsd.org, svn-src-all@freebsd.org, src-committers@freebsd.org
Subject:   Re: svn commit: r240899 - head/sys/dev/ath
Message-ID:  <CAGH67wQXZOPUWzKoVOWSJt3s63E4Z1c1VP1G3bO1yeiCZCHDsw@mail.gmail.com>
In-Reply-To: <201209242035.q8OKZvUM093772@svn.freebsd.org>
References:  <201209242035.q8OKZvUM093772@svn.freebsd.org>

next in thread | previous in thread | raw e-mail | index | archive | help
--bcaec550b604d1145e04cb44aa73
Content-Type: text/plain; charset=ISO-8859-1

On Mon, Sep 24, 2012 at 1:35 PM, Adrian Chadd <adrian@freebsd.org> wrote:
> Author: adrian
> Date: Mon Sep 24 20:35:56 2012
> New Revision: 240899
> URL: http://svn.freebsd.org/changeset/base/240899
>
> Log:
>   Migrate the ath(4) KTR logging to use an ATH_KTR() macro.
>
>   This should eventually be unified with ATH_DEBUG() so I can get both
>   from one macro; that may take some time.
>
>   Add some new probes for TX and TX completion.

    This commit broke the non-IEEE80211_SUPPORT_TDMA case. My attached
patch fixes it by better unifying the IEEE80211_SUPPORT_TDMA and
non-IEEE80211_SUPPORT_TDMA cases where it made sense (it could be
further unified, but that might make things more convoluted).
Thanks!
-Garrett

--bcaec550b604d1145e04cb44aa73
Content-Type: application/octet-stream; 
	name="fix-if_ath_tx-non-IEEE80211_SUPPORT_TDMA.patch"
Content-Disposition: attachment; 
	filename="fix-if_ath_tx-non-IEEE80211_SUPPORT_TDMA.patch"
Content-Transfer-Encoding: base64
X-Attachment-Id: f_h7wjb0230

SW5kZXg6IGRldi9hdGgvaWZfYXRoX3R4LmMKPT09PT09PT09PT09PT09PT09PT09PT09PT09PT09
P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PQotLS0gZGV2L2F0aC9pZl9hdGhf
dHguYwkocmV2aXNpb24gMjQxMjEzKQorKysgZGV2L2F0aC9pZl9hdGhfdHguYwkod29ya2luZyBj
b3B5KQpAQCAtNzI1LDE1ICs3MjUsMTkgQEAKIAogCS8qIEZvciBub3csIHNvIG5vdCB0byBnZW5l
cmF0ZSB3aGl0ZXNwYWNlIGRpZmZzICovCiAJaWYgKDEpIHsKLSNpZmRlZiBJRUVFODAyMTFfU1VQ
UE9SVF9URE1BCiAJCWludCBxYnVzeTsKIAogCQlBVEhfVFhRX0lOU0VSVF9UQUlMKHR4cSwgYmYs
IGJmX2xpc3QpOwogCQlxYnVzeSA9IGF0aF9oYWxfdHhxZW5hYmxlZChhaCwgdHhxLT5heHFfcW51
bSk7Ci0KIAkJQVRIX0tUUihzYywgQVRIX0tUUl9UWCwgNCwKLQkJICAgICJhdGhfdHhfaGFuZG9m
ZjogdHhxPSV1LCBhZGQgYmY9JXAsIHFidXN5PSVkLCBkZXB0aD0lZCIsCisJCSAgICAiYXRoX3R4
X2hhbmRvZmYlczogdHhxPSV1LCBhZGQgYmY9JXAsIHFidXN5PSVkLCBkZXB0aD0lZCIsCisjaWZk
ZWYgSUVFRTgwMjExX1NVUFBPUlRfVERNQQorCQkgICAgIiIKKyNlbHNlCisJCSAgICAiOiBub24t
dGRtYSIKKyNlbmRpZgogCQkgICAgdHhxLT5heHFfcW51bSwgYmYsIHFidXN5LCB0eHEtPmF4cV9k
ZXB0aCk7CisjaWZkZWYgSUVFRTgwMjExX1NVUFBPUlRfVERNQQogCQlpZiAodHhxLT5heHFfbGlu
ayA9PSBOVUxMKSB7CiAJCQkvKgogCQkJICogQmUgY2FyZWZ1bCB3cml0aW5nIHRoZSBhZGRyZXNz
IHRvIFRYRFAuICBJZgpAQCAtODA4LDE0ICs4MTIsNiBAQAogCQkJfQogCQl9CiAjZWxzZQotCQlB
VEhfVFhRX0lOU0VSVF9UQUlMKHR4cSwgYmYsIGJmX2xpc3QpOwotCQlBVEhfS1RSKHNjLCBBVEhf
S1RSX1RYLCA0LAotCQkgICAgImF0aF90eF9oYW5kb2ZmOiBub24tdGRtYTogdHhxPSV1LCBhZGQg
YmY9JXAsIHFidXN5PSVkLCAiCi0JCSAgICAiZGVwdGg9JWQiLAotCQkgICAgdHhxLT5heHFfcW51
bSwKLQkJICAgIGJmLAotCQkgICAgcWJ1c3ksCi0JCSAgICB0eHEtPmF4cV9kZXB0aCk7CiAJCWlm
ICh0eHEtPmF4cV9saW5rID09IE5VTEwpIHsKIAkJCWF0aF9oYWxfcHV0dHhidWYoYWgsIHR4cS0+
YXhxX3FudW0sIGJmLT5iZl9kYWRkcik7CiAJCQlEUFJJTlRGKHNjLCBBVEhfREVCVUdfWE1JVCwK
--bcaec550b604d1145e04cb44aa73--



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?CAGH67wQXZOPUWzKoVOWSJt3s63E4Z1c1VP1G3bO1yeiCZCHDsw>